Harmi Palda has been producing evocative electronic music since 2005 with releases on Boltfish, Rednetic and Toytronic Records accompanying performances at Glastonbury and Bestival.

With The Value of Accessibility, Harmi combines his unique sense of emotive melody with meticulous attention to detail - threading acidic streaks through an atmosphere both foreboding and uplifting.

In Harmi’s own words: “The title refers to the mountain of accessible information that we can retrieve at any time from the internet. We can listen and access music whenever we want - the value of which we must understand and appreciate. No one really has the time to step away from this and truly imagine what life was like prior to the internet. This is an expression of the information we have on tap, that once not long ago was an act of travelling to libraries, music shops, travel agents…..”.

Quintillions of bytes of data are created daily, over 40,000 songs are added to Spotify every day, 300,000 hours of video uploaded to YouTube every minute. And we are just at the start.

Yet there is still time to reflect, discover and value this accessibility and there’s no better way to do that than via discovering new music….

In reflection of this theme, a server sits impassive and centre piece in the custom cover art from Bristol based Mark Hollis. Information spews from the colourful objects dotted around an otherworldly landscape within an atmosphere both bleak and colourful.

Infinite Scale is a producer, DJ, broadcaster, and musician.

Scale started making music in 1997 with an Ensonic EPS 16+ 2mb sampler, which he still uses in his studio set up to this day.

He has been commissioned to compose music for the BBC, both on radio and TV, and has done sessions for the late great Breezeblock on Radio 1, and at Maida Vale for The Blue Room.
